Transaction 77392c22f821edcd378c17fd19d09eb564863fc29faa2c3e0835a613ea917edd
1 Input
1 Output
-
77392c22f821edcd378c17fd19d09eb564863fc29faa2c3e0835a613ea917edd:0
- value
- 83871
- script pubkey
- OP_0 OP_PUSHBYTES_20 2b59413f24592cc25e951945a5e81de8d606c2f7
- address
- bc1q9dv5z0eytykvyh54r9z6t6qaartqdshhekvemn